Wall Surface Maintenance
Checking walls for any kind of flaws and quickly addressing them via necessary fixings is essential for attaining a smooth and remarkable paint work. Before starting the painting procedure, thoroughly take a look at the walls for splits, holes, damages, or any other damage that can affect the outcome.
Beginning by filling in any cracks or openings with spackling substance, permitting it to completely dry completely before sanding it down to produce a smooth surface. For larger damages or damaged locations, take into consideration making use of joint compound to ensure a smooth repair work.
In addition, check for any type of loosened paint or wallpaper that might require to be eliminated. Scrape off any type of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face area to produce a consistent structure.
It's likewise essential to evaluate for water damages, as this can result in mold and mildew growth and affect the attachment of the brand-new paint. Deal with any kind of water discolorations or mildew with the suitable cleaning options prior to waging the painting process.
Cleaning and Surface Preparation
To make certain an excellent and well-prepared surface area for painting, the following step involves thoroughly cleansing and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by dusting view it with a microfiber cloth or a duster to remove any type of loose dirt, cobwebs, or particles.
For more stubborn dust or grime, a service of light detergent and water can be made use of to delicately scrub the walls, complied with by a thorough rinse with tidy water. Pay special focus to areas near light buttons, door deals with, and baseboards, as these tend to collect more dirt.
After cleaning, it is necessary to evaluate the wall surfaces for any fractures, holes, or imperfections. These must be filled with spackling substance and sanded smooth once completely dry. Sanding the wall surfaces lightly with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ly additionally aid create an uniform surface for painting.
Priming and Insulation
Before painting, the walls must be topped to guarantee appropriate adhesion of the paint and taped to safeguard surrounding surface areas from stray brushstrokes. Priming acts as a crucial action in the paint procedure, specifically for new drywall or surface areas that have been patched or fixed. It helps secure the wall, developing a smooth and uniform surface for the paint to abide by. Furthermore, guide can enhance the sturdiness and coverage of the paint, ultimately bring about a more specialist and lasting surface.
